构建私有云平台是一项复杂的任务,需要考虑到安全性、可用性、扩展性等多个方面。下面是构建私有云平台的一般步骤:
硬件设备准备:
购买高性能的服务器、存储设备,满足计算和存储需求。
部署网络设备,包括交换机、路由器等,搭建稳定的内部网络。
软件配置:
安装虚拟化软件:选择合适的虚拟化平台,如VMware、OpenStack等,搭建虚拟化环境。
设置存储:配置共享存储系统,提供可靠的存储服务。
配置网络:设置网络拓扑结构,规划IP地址、子网等,确保网络通信正常。
设置安全策略:制定安全策略,包括访问控制、防火墙设置等,保护私有云平台的安全。
资源管理与调度:
创建虚拟机模板:根据实际需求,创建各种虚拟机模板,以便快速部署新的虚拟机。
资源池管理:设置资源池,对计算和存储资源进行管理和调度,实现资源的高效利用。
自动化运维:使用运维工具和配置管理系统,实现自动化部署、监控和故障处理。
基础服务提供:
配置网络服务:提供 DNS、DHCP、负载均衡等网络服务,保证整个云平台的正常运行。
提供身份认证与授权:实现用户认证、角色管理和访问控制,确保资源的安全性。
设置备份与恢复策略:建立数据备份和灾难恢复机制,确保数据的可靠性和业务的连续性。
监控与优化:
配置监控系统:设置监控指标和告警规则,实时监控云平台的各项指标。
进行性能优化:根据监控数据,对云平台进行性能优化和容量规划,提升整体性能。